Enjoy a vibrant and offbeat vibe in Berkeley

A quintessential college town on San Francisco Bay, Berkeley has long been celebrated as the birthplace of free speech. The modern Berkeley is perhaps better associated with artistic flair and culinary bounty, although there’s still a whiff of hippie idealism in the air. Stay close to the action with a Berkeley vacation rental near the park-like campus of the University of California, Berkeley or enjoy the seclusion of a home in the forested foothill range, many of which combine classic craftsman design with modern comforts and sumptuous views of the bay.

Live the good life in Berkeley

The foodie scene in Berkeley rivals any found in the Bay Area, although you’ll likely find the prices a little lower and a greater focus on ethnic cuisine, particularly in the tantalizing Telegraph Avenue area. As you might expect, student hangouts and hip coffee shops offering relaxed dining are prevalent here, but if you want an authentic Bay Area dining experience, farm-to-table restaurants are also on the menu. If retail therapy is on your agenda, you can combine shopping with sightseeing as you search for flash new wardrobe additions at the local favorite, College Avenue, and the more upscale Fourth Street.

Discover Berkeley’s ancient volcano

While Golden Gate Park may be synonymous with the Bay Area, Berkeley is by no means a runner-up when it comes to lush green spaces. Tilden Regional Park, stretching along the city’s northeast border, offers the chance to hike, swim, or simply relax and admire the sunset over San Francisco Bay. You can also get back to nature at the nearby Sibley Volcanic Regional Preserve, where places to wander include the 31-mile East Bay Skyline Recreation Trail. If that sounds too strenuous, a much shorter volcanic trail that leads gently to the top of Round Top, one of the area’s highest peaks, is a less challenging alternative.

Transportation to and around Berkeley

The nearest airport is in Oakland Intl. Airport (OAK), located 11.5 mi (18.5 km) from the city center. If you can't find a flight that's convenient for your trip, you could also fly into San Francisco Intl. Airport (SFO), which is 18.8 mi (30.2 km) away.

If you're traveling by train, the main station serving the city is Berkeley Station. You can see more of Berkeley by catching a ride on the metro at Downtown Berkeley Station, North Berkeley Station or Ashby Station.

What are the top attractions in Berkeley, California, United States of America?
In Berkeley, visitors can explore a variety of attractions that highlight the city's unique culture and natural beauty. The University of California, Berkeley campus is a major draw, featuring the iconic Sather Tower (Campanile) and the beautiful Botanical Garden, offering diverse plant species and scenic views. Nearby, the Berkeley Art Museum and Pacific Film Archive provides a rich collection of contemporary art and film screenings.

For outdoor enthusiasts, Tilden Regional Park offers hiking trails, a lake for swimming, and a working farm, all just a short drive from the city center. The nearby Gourmet Ghetto area is famous for its culinary offerings, including the original Peet's Coffee and a variety of farm-to-table restaurants that celebrate local produce.

The Telegraph Avenue area is vibrant with shops, cafes, and street vendors, making it a lively spot for visitors to soak in the local atmosphere. Additionally, the Berkeley Marina provides waterfront views, picnic areas, and access to the Adventure Playground, making it ideal for families.
